Some of us like to talk a lot, but others talk less. It is not always easy to control what we say. "He who never stumbles over his words is perfect and able to restrain his whole body also" (James 3: 2, 3). James was referring to the brake that is placed on the horses' head and mouth. When the rider pulls the reins, he can guide the animal or make it stop. But, if you lose control, the horse can run wild and hurt itself or injure the rider. Similarly, if we don't control what we say, we can do a lot of damage. The wise King Solomon wrote by inspiration: "When many words are said, it is inevitable to sin, but the one who stops their lips acts with prudence." (Prov. 10:19). If we listen carefully to others and think before speaking, our words will be like those golden apples: precious and of great value. We must learn that Silence is an Art.
